DNS PROBE FINISHED NXDOMAIN Error in Chrome

While you attempt to enter an internet site by typing its Title, the online browser in your pc takes the assistance of DNS Server to seek out IP Handle of the web site that you're attempting to enter.

For instance, for those who kind YouTube in Chrome browser, the DNS server mechanically provides Chrome with the IP Handle (216.58.218.110) of this web site.

Nonetheless, typically the DNS Server fails to offer Chrome with this data, which ends up in DNS Failure error messages.

The Error code DNS PROBE FINISHED NXDOMAIN is mainly attempting to let you know that DNS Lookup failed when Chrome browser tried to enter the online web page that you simply had been attempting to enter.

2. Flush DNS Cache

Comply with the steps beneath to Flush the DNS Cache on your pc.

1. Proper-click on the Begin button and click on on Command Immediate (admin).

Start Button and Command Prompt (Admin) Tab in Windows 10

2. On Command Immediate window, kind ipconfig / flushdns and press the enter key.

As soon as this Command is executed, attempt to open the webpage that you simply had been attempting to enter.

This time, you need to be able to attain the web site with out encountering any error messages from Chrome browser.

3. Reset Community Adapter (Winsock Reset)

Comply with the steps beneath to Reset the Community Adapter in your Home windows 10pc.

1. Proper-click on Begin button and click on on Command Immediate (admin).

2. On the Command Immediate window, kind netsh winsock reset and press the Enter key.

netsh winsock reset Command in Windows 10

3. It's good to Restart your pc for this modification to be applied.

4. Swap to Google DNS

In case you are incessantly experiencing sluggish downs and Error Messages, you'll be able to think about the choice of switching to Google DNS or OpenDNS.

Each Google and OpenDNS are recognized to be extremely dependable and are prone to be faster than the DNS Servers used by your Web Service Supplier.

1. Open Settings > click on on Community & Web.

2. On the following display, scroll down and click on Community & Sharing Center hyperlink.

3. On the Community and Sharing Middle Display screen, click on in your WiFi Community Title.

4. On the following display (WiFi Standing), click on on the Properties possibility (See picture beneath)

Be aware: You may be prompted to enter your Admin Password, in case you aren't logged in along with your Admin Account.

5. On the WiFi Properties display, choose Web Protocol Model 4 (TCP/IPv4) and click on on the Properties button.

6. On the following display, choose Use the next DNS Server addresses possibility and enter 8.8.8.8 within the field subsequent to Most well-liked DNS Server and eight.8.4.4 within the field subsequent to Alternate DNS server.

7. Click on on OK to save lots of the brand new DNS Server settings.

With above steps you can have efficiently modified the DNS Server on your pc to Google DNS.

Be aware: In case you need to use OpenDNS, kind 208.67.222.222 within the Most well-liked DNS server field and 208.67.220.220 in Alternate DNS Server field.
